Q: Is 47,412,523 a Prime Number?
A: No, 47,412,523 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 47412523 can be evenly divided by 1 41 1,156,403 and 47,412,523, with no remainder.
Since 47,412,523 cannot be divided by just 1 and 47,412,523, it is not a prime number.
